Downranking youtube promotes porn even in safe search #52

Description

@jimboolio

Hello!

I'm working on a goggle which downranks "too popular websites" with the aim that I'd see smaller creators more often.

It seems like the videos section in search results is mandatory, so if I heavily downrank youtube, which often populates the video results, the video results are still there but with not so exact matches, very often porn. This happens even on safe search moderate setting.

It seems hard to downrank porn with the current goggles syntax, since the domain and path often do not contain relevant keywords for successful downranking, instead the intitle option could be useful here. Relevant keyword downranks still do decrease the frequency, helping a bit.

If Brave has safe-search team etc. they could find this useful:

$site=youtube.com,discard

Alternatively I hope that I could disable/hide the video results completely, or to make them appear based on their assumed relevancy, currently the video results are always at the top.
